Udemy
    •  
    •  
    •  
    •  
    •  
    •  
    •  
    •  
Turn what you know into an opportunity and reach millions around the world.
Learn More
Your cart is empty.
Keep shopping
フロントエンドエンジニアのための React アプリケーション開発入門 2018年版
Rating: 3.8 out of 5(1,980 ratings)
10,297 students
Last updated 5/2026
Japanese

What you'll learn

  • 実践的かつモダンなフロントエンド開発手法を学ぶことができる
  • CRUD(作成、参照、更新、削除)ができる動的なReactアプリケーションの実装方法を学ぶことができる
  • 外部のRESTful APIと連携する動的なReactアプリケーションの開発手順及び開発方法を体得することができる
  • 現場のベテランエンジニアが開発をする際に気をつける点について、コードを書きながら学ぶことができる
  • 初学者がやってしまう間違いについて学ぶことができる

Course content

9 sections49 lectures7h 29m total length
  • プロモーショナルビデオ5:54
  • 本コースの全ソースコードはこちら2:48

Requirements

  • HTML、CSS、JavaScriptの基礎知識
  • macOSあるいはLinux ※Windowsパソコンを使用した開発環境の構築はご案内しておりませんので予めご了承ください
  • Google Chromeブラウザの最新版
  • テキストエディタ(Visual Studio Code、Atom、vim等お好みのもの)
  • 動画で紹介する手順の通りにならない場合でも、諦めることなく質問して解決しようとする意欲や積極性
  • Nodeのバージョンはv8.9.4が推奨です

Description

本コースでは、フロントエンドUser Interface開発のためJavaScriptのライブラとして多くの開発者に支持されているReactを題材にし、実際にコーディングを進めながらReactプログラミング技術を習得するという内容になっています。 また、よくReactとセットで用いられる状態管理のためのライブラリであるReduxについても学んで頂けるコースとなっています。

プログラミング習得のための最大の近道は、「とにかく書いて動かすこと!」というのが私の信念です。ReactReduxの習得の学習コストは高いと言われていますが、 とにかく、コードを書いて、その挙動を目で確認しながら、まるでゲームをしているかのごとく体得してもらうことが最も効率的だと私は考えており、このコースの内容もその信念に基づいて設計しています。

本コースの中では受講生の皆様に外部サーバと連携するアプリケーションを開発して頂きます。それはいわゆるCRUDアプリケーションで自在に外部のRESTful APIサーバと連携しながらデータを外部サーバに永続化できる実用的なアプリケーションで現実世界にもよく見かける形態の一つですので、実際の業務にも応用できる技術と言えます。

こんなアプリケーションの実装について興味を持たれた方は是非本コースをご受講ください。

また、何か問題が起きた場合もご安心ください。UdemyではQ&Aを通じて講師と共にその問題を解決しながらコースに取り組んで頂ける仕組みがあります。是非この仕組も十分に活用頂き本コースを通じて皆様の成長のために貢献できるよう頑張ります!

では、本コースでお会いできるのを楽しみにしております!

Who this course is for:

  • モダンなフロントエンド開発の知識を身に付けたい方
  • jQueryの使用経験はあるがReactの使用経験はなく、Reactを使用してみたいとお考えの方
  • サーバーサイドと連携するフロントエンドアプリケーションの開発方法を修得したい方